> I am looking for some info
> 
> system:  PIII-500 / 500 MRam / Win98SE / Mozilla 1.7.5 / ZAP 5.5.062.011
>            AVG 7.0
> 
> problem:  Down loads do not start / stop part way along.
> 
> When this happens I have to shut down / restart the browser to even get 
> to "surf again".  It seems to be browser related because, changing to 
> IE, and returning to the same site enables me to get what I was looking 
> for.  Last place was the site for Wall Watcher.  Three tries for 
> mozilla.  No go.  One try for IE.
> 
> Perfs set:  cookies custom / image from originating site / script off 
> mostly, but on for some sites (hot mail ect)
> 
> Any Ideas ??
> 
> thanks

In your Mozilla program directory /components/ directory, delete the
file compreg.dat and try again. Still doesn't work? Locate your profile
directory and delete the file downloads.rdf .. For both procedures make
sure Mozilla is closed first.
